Daegu
7.1/10
$2,100/month · South Korea
GO- Significantly cheaper than Seoul for rent and daily costs
- Excellent Korean food scene with famous markets
- KTX high-speed rail to Seoul in under 2 hours
- Nicknamed "Daegu the Furnace" — summers regularly exceed 37°C
- English proficiency is noticeably lower than Seoul
- Smaller international community and fewer coworking spaces
Seoul
7.9/10
$3,595/month · South Korea
GO- Insanely fast internet and connectivity everywhere
- One of the safest major cities in the world
- World-class public transportation system
- Apartment deposits can be astronomically high
- Korean language barrier is steep
- Winters are brutally cold
